Crawfordsville Journal Review 6-Aug-1965 -- Waynetown - Mary V. Bolen, 92, died at 6:15
p.m. Thursday in Waynetown. She had been bedfast 5 months, her condition becoming serious
a week ago. A native of Hamilton County, she was born Nov 4, 1872 near Noblesville to
David and Mary Ann Owen Harris. She married George Bolen at her home there Aug 20, 1894.
He died Sept 13, 1954. Since then she made her home with her children. Mrs. Bolen was a
member of the Walnut Grove Church at State Line and attended Liberty Church north of
Waynetown. She was a member of the Liberty Ladies Aid. She was educated at Noblesville
and moved to Montgomery County 57 years ago. Surviving are two sons, Forest Bolen of Rt 2,
Waynetown and Leland; two daughters, Mrs. Carrie Merrell of Rt. 2, Waynetown and Mrs.
Gertrude Hayes of Crawfordsville; 8 grandchildren; 14 great grandchildren and three
sisters, Mrs. Vina Jones of Denver, Colo, Mrs. Nellie Messick of Rankin, Ill and Mrs.
Pearl Bohn of Curlew, Iowa. She was preceded in death by two grandchildren, a sister and
three brothers. Funeral services are set for 2 p.m. Saturday at Servies Funeral Home with
Rev. John Servies officiating and interment in Waynetown masonic Cemetery.
